Essential Skills for M.Tech Manufacturing Science Graduates

To excel in M.Tech Manufacturing Science, a blend of technical and soft skills is essential. Here's a breakdown of the key skills required:

Technical Skills:

  • CAD/CAM/CAE: Proficiency in Computer-Aided Design, Manufacturing, and Engineering software is fundamental for design, simulation, and analysis.
  • Manufacturing Processes: A deep understanding of various manufacturing processes like casting, machining, welding, and forming is crucial.
  • Automation & Robotics: Knowledge of automation technologies, robotics, and control systems is increasingly important in modern manufacturing.
  • Lean Manufacturing & Six Sigma: Familiarity with lean principles and Six Sigma methodologies for process optimization and quality improvement.
  • Materials Science: Understanding the properties and behavior of different materials used in manufacturing is essential for material selection and processing.
  • Quality Control & Assurance: Expertise in quality control techniques, statistical process control, and quality management systems.

Soft Skills:

  • Problem-Solving: The ability to identify and solve complex manufacturing problems using analytical and critical thinking skills.
  • Communication: Effective communication skills, both written and verbal, are necessary for collaborating with teams and presenting technical information.
  • Teamwork: The ability to work effectively in a team environment and contribute to achieving common goals.
  • Project Management: Skills in planning, organizing, and executing manufacturing projects within budget and timelines.
  • Leadership: The ability to lead and motivate teams, make decisions, and drive continuous improvement initiatives.

Additional Skills:

  • Data Analysis: Skills in data analysis and interpretation using tools like Excel, Python, or statistical software.
  • Programming: Basic programming skills in languages like Python or MATLAB for automation and data processing.

Developing these skills through coursework, projects, and internships will significantly enhance career prospects for M.Tech Manufacturing Science graduates.

An M.Tech in Manufacturing Science offers diverse specializations catering to various interests and career goals. Here are some of the most sought-after specializations:

  • Advanced Manufacturing Processes: Focuses on cutting-edge manufacturing techniques like additive manufacturing (3D printing), laser processing, and micro-manufacturing.

  • CAD/CAM/CAE: Specializes in computer-aided design, manufacturing, and engineering, emphasizing simulation and optimization of manufacturing processes.

  • Automation and Robotics: Deals with the integration of automation and robotics in manufacturing systems, including robot programming, control systems, and industrial automation.

  • Manufacturing Systems Engineering: Focuses on the design, analysis, and optimization of manufacturing systems, including lean manufacturing, supply chain management, and operations research.

  • Materials Engineering: Concentrates on the selection, processing, and characterization of materials used in manufacturing, including metals, polymers, and composites.

  • Quality Engineering and Management: Emphasizes quality control, statistical process control, and quality management systems to ensure product quality and process efficiency.

  • Sustainable Manufacturing: Focuses on environmentally friendly manufacturing practices, including waste reduction, energy efficiency, and green manufacturing technologies.

Choosing the right specialization depends on your interests and career aspirations. Researching the curriculum and faculty expertise of different programs is crucial for making an informed decision. Consider the industry trends and future job prospects associated with each specialization.
